Personalisation Framework
Some institutional examples
– Lewisham College ‘Transformation’ Rise of 24% in student retention
– Exeter University ‘Students as Agents of Change’‘Online Coursework Project’
– Manchester Metropolitan UniversityDistributed VLE’sTransforming Feedback
